My Dear Mother
Sept 25th 1863 Still Remain on Pea Patch Island
The prosspecks of getting back to Dixie I see none atall its very Disharting here in prison at Fort delaware So many of our men diing Thirteen or Foreteen a day was confined to my bed about 8 days But at the present time I am so as I can get about again Thank God for it
Saterday Sept 26th 63. Some moore of our troops leaves here today. Virginia & Maryland troops They was about 700 of the western men got of the 18th of this month. we suppose that they was taken to sitty point and exchange but some doubt it very much

I an the rest of my Comrads was some what uplifted an chered in heart on the acount of hearing the 26 of Sept that Gen Johnson and Bragg had give Gen Roseincrans a whiping in the road &c. an that some of our prisonners left Fort Delaware on the 18th and some on the 26th Sept

The last men we had to leive this prison was on the 24th of Oct. 1863 they are about 2000. Prisonners here yet I think Its reported here that our men dont go to dixie they go to Point lookout in Md The Names of Troops was called today, Oct 28th 1863. Fort Delaware
Fryday Oct 30th 1863 I am expecking to leive Fort delaware today or tomorrow Saterday.
Wednesday Nov 4th 1863. Fore months today since I was captured by the yankees at Chambersburg Penna

This is a list of my acquaintances at Fort Delaware
John A. B. Crooks belonging to the same Co that I do
Though I do no
Tunner Raye a member of the 2nd Miss Regt
T. J. Graham a member of Co B 3rd So. Ca Regt.
John. L. Clamp belonging to the same Co & Regt
Ace Parker of Co L 9th So Ca Regt. T. K. Misshow
of Co L 7th So. Ca Regt. Robbert C. Clyne of Co. C.
2nd So. Ca Calvary Regt. Prisonnors here with
Mee at fort Delaware J. B. Campbell Co. B. 3rd So. Ca. Regt.
the nomber of Prisonnors here is estamated at
About 8 or ten 1000 men greate many taken
the oath and going in the yankee army & a
greate many of our true men are running the
Blockade trying to get of home is their object

The 4th of July I was captured at or near Chambersburg and taken to Shipingsburg remain
Saterday Fort Delaware, Del.
theare untill the 5th then the march was continued that day to Carlyle. Seven miles from
Wednesday Dec 14th 64 Pleasant
Chambersburg to Shipingsburg and 21 from Shipingsburg to Carlyle and we stayed the 5th night and 6th We taken the cars and went to Harrisburg and stayed theare untill the 7th and then was taken to Philadelphia and the 8th I was taken to Fort delaware Which I remain here yet. August 5th/63.
